Hi Guys
Dads old s40 2L Petrol, Non Turbo, Manual trans (Stick) - has a newish motor +- 10000 km now.
New Plugs
When you take off is stutters for a split second and then through-out the rev range it seems to continue stuttering every now and then.
However on the Freeway / Highway at 120KM/h -- NOT -- under any harsh loads it seems a bit smoother.
Any advice would be appreciated

Just all the normal suspects - plugs, coils, injectors, PCV valves, vacuum leaks. Really bad motor / transmission mounts can make it feel like an engine miss, too.
Check for stored OBD codes - that might tell you something to help you narrow down the search area to less than a continent... ;-)

Hey check your sensors if you can I suspect MAF is the case here if the car is stuttering or hesitant on acceleration also uneven idle can be MAF if you don't have diagnostic you should check the MAF maf can be checked for resistance and voltage using ohm meter voltmeter also worth checking your cam and crank sensors however live data diagnostic would pinpoint your problem v quickly
